Great Pictures But Lots of Flaws in Execution: Buy With Caution
This book is a mixed bag. I’ll list the pros and cons so you can decide for yourself: Pros: +Lots of nice pictures +Reference “answer key” in the back of completed pics +Nice book size (not too small, not too big) +Nice pixel size (I didn’t find them too small) +Spiral binding is good quality & handy Cons: -I am normally great at distinguishing like colors, but since this book relies on a lot of shading, it can get insane! Even with 108 Tombows I had trouble figuring out some. See the example with 10 very close shades of light/gray blue!!! -No color key either, so it’s not like if you figure it out for one pic you can use that to help with another -All this means you may spend 10x more time figuring out the colors than you will coloring it -Paper is THIN. Like, even thinner than CreateSpace! So pretty much everything will shadow or bleed to the other side (see pics) -Double-sided pics mean if you don’t use something like light pencil you may not be able to color both sides -Cover is SUPER thin, not much thicker than the paper, and mine came already ripped -Color key uses LETTERS, not numbers: for me, it’s a lot easier to confuse since I’m mildly dyslexic, than numbers are, so I definitely made some mistakes Final Thoughts: Once I figure out the colors, I really had a blast coloring the pics. But with so many similar shades and no consistency between pics, it makes for a frustrating experience. You NEED to have a large set of pens/markers/pencils— I would suggest a MINIMUM of 72, and 100+ would be better. I have a chronic illness so colored pencils aren’t always an option; markers use a lot less force and are less painful for me to use. So I was very disappointed that I couldn’t use the markers I had wanted to, and even the tombows with a light touch shadowed/bled. I understand the book is inexpensive and all, but it may prove too difficult/stressful for those who like color by number precisely BECAUSE it’s relaxing and easy. I’ll definitely keep the book and color other pics, but I’m not sure if I’ll buy others from this company.

Squares are way too small
I was excited to see a color by number in spiral form to be easier to color with. When I got this book I was disappointed. The squares are way too small, making the triangle half squares way smaller. You would have to use a sharp pencil everytime you see a triangle. Also I don’t like how they’re double sided. The last thing that was a deal breaker. The color key is horrible!!! Each picture has a different color key! The letter “A” color for one picture is different for the next. Plus how would you match a color based on the picture. I wish it was consistent on colors and e letters with all the pictures. I will stick to my Mindware color by numbers. Those I highly recommend if you’re looking for a color by number.
